All 64 Roses are due to meet their official escorts for the first time at the Kingdom Greyhound Stadium on Tuesday (15 August) at Rose Race Day 2017 with gates open from 5.30PM. The ten race meeting will start at 6.58PM. Rose Race Day 2017 will also be a fun filled family evening with face painting, a bouncy castle along with all your favourite cartoon characters to keep the children entertained. This will also be an opportunity to meet and mingle with the 64 Roses.

The current Rose of Tralee Maggie McEldowney will make the presentation to the winner of the 2017 Speedrite Dog Food Rose of Tralee Final. Patrons attending Rose Race Day 2017 will also be in for a chance to win a pair of the much sought-after tickets to the Rose Ball in the Dome on Friday (18 August).
Jasmine Boutique in Tralee will proudly sponsor the Best Dressed Lady Competition with a first prize of €200 voucher with two runners up prizes.
